O Reilly: It felt difficult to just change to play at the left back, but I received a lot of suggestions and I enjoyed it.

6:30am, 7 October 2025Football

October 7th News Not long ago, Manchester City teenager O'Reilly was interviewed and talked about his debut under Guardiola and his change from a No. 10 player to a left-back.

How was your mother at that time? Did she scream? Have you cried? How did she react?

"Well, she was actually very shocked, a little speechless. But yes, she was really excited."

You were originally a midfielder, but now you are changing to the left-back. What do you think of the change in this position?

"Yes, I thought it was difficult at first because I had never played that position before. But I was training and playing that position every day, so it became easier later. I received a lot of good suggestions, and I could feel that everyone liked me playing this position. Although it was a bit different, I enjoyed it."

What are the suggestions you received?

"Uh, it's more tactical suggestions, such as asking me to practice defense more. Because I feel that I am learning every day, constantly improving in this position, and enjoying more and more."

What did Guardiola say to you playing in this position?

"Well, he just said he wished I was a little more aggressive, and obviously he knew what I could do when I was in possession. I grew up from Manchester City's youth training system, so I'm really glad he trusted me."
